Sanguine Soldier Custom PrC: Auras
"Blood is beautiful / the scarlet essence of life / and crimson of death." - Sanguine Soldier Haiku
Sanguine Soldiers are considered bloodthirsty madmen, whose desires to spill blood can lead even to self mutilation just to see the essence of life dripping from their flesh. The most renown for better or worse are known to stand in fields of blood at the peak of their power, craving more blood to be spilled. Some show enough restraint to let their prey live, but it is not uncommon for them to finish their enemies in the bloodiest of fashions.
As one of these madmen and madwomen, you become perfectly fine with taking damage as well as dishing it out. Masters have even been known to defy the effects of their own bloodlust for a time. You will bleed, and you will cause others to bleed, if not for the sure ecstasy of it then for the power that will flow through your veins. Whether or not you are truly crazy, there will be no shaking the stigma that comes from any who know of the Sanguine Soldiers.
Abilities are mostly considered physical. Prerequisites

Lvl 1:
- Hot-Blooded
At will your blood begins to warm inside of your veins, increasing your temperature, destroying simple diseases, makes you resistant to both magical and normal cold, while also making you more difficult to detect in warmer temperatures and your blood is capable of burning like boiling water when spilled.
It takes at least one post to change from normal temperature to hot-blooded, unless the user is subject to heat, in which case the change will be immediate. It takes two posts to lower the user's temperature to normal levels under normal circumstances, and four posts when already subjected to heat, but while subject to either cold it takes two posts to increase temperature, while only taking one post to revert to normal temperatures.
- Cold-Blooded
At will your blood turns cold, lowering your temperature and making you harder to detect by body temperature in normal and colder environments, as well as numbing your pain and slowing bleeding. You also become resistant to heat. However you do not fully realize when you are injured and react slower. Your blood, when spilled, can chill just short of freezing.
It takes at least one post to change from normal temperature to cold-blooded, unless the user is subject to cold, in which case the change will be immediate. It takes two posts to raise the user's temperature to normal levels under normal circumstances, and four posts when already subjected to cold, but while subject to heat it takes two posts to increase temperature, while only taking one post to revert to normal temperatures.
Lvl 2:
- Blood for Blood
Once per five posts, or two minutes, you can turn spilled natural blood of any sort into the designated willing target's blood and have it enter their veins, purified of things such as dirt or simple bacteria but not of things such as poisons. This ability is mostly useful for blood transfusions.
Lvl 3:
- Out for Blood
You are able to turn your own blood into dangerous weapons. These weapons are sharp but as fragile as glass and can be formed from within the veins of the Sanguine Soldier. At any time the weapons created through this effect can be safely returned to the bloodstream without damaging the user so long as they are in contact with it. After one hour outside of the Sanguine Soldier's touch weapons created through this effect will return to being a liquid. Additionally you can track enemies damaged by Out for Blood weapons up to 300ft.
Properties of the user's blood, such as blood from the grafting shop, are present in their Out for Blood weapons. Out for Blood weapons count as natural weapons.
When exposed to flames, the weapons made through Out for Blood will shatter and catch aflame.
Lvl 4:
- Covenant of Blood
Through blood you can create a contract with an ally. You may mimic any buff a player-controlled ally earns through abilities or spells, but you suffer any damage your ally takes you will also suffer and vice verse, but this also applies to healing effects.
- Blood Destruction
You can turn any exposed, connected blood that you touch into an explosive blast once every two turns dealing moderate damage to all enemies in the vicinity. The effective area of Blood Destruction is relative to how much blood has been spilled (IE: Moderate amount of blood results in a medium area). If used on an Out for Blood weapon, the blood erupts away from the Sanguine Soldier in shards doing moderate damage but the blood becomes unrecoverable for the Sanguine Soldier.
Lvl 5:
- Blood Drive
The more blood spilled the better. When the blood of others is spilled your Sanguine Soldier abilities become somewhat more interesting. Your own blood doesn't count towards this ability as it is already a part of you. Artificial blood created through magic or alchemy (substituted magic or blood from healing spells) counts for substantially less than natural blood, (IE: 1 post of a rain spell substituted into blood counts as a minor amount of blood. 5 posts moderate. 10 posts major.)
For example
- Minor amount of blood
Hot-Blooded: Slight increase in physical speed. Cold-Blooded: Non-magical physical weakness flaws (Such as Glass Jaw, Bruise Easily, or Fragility) no longer affect you..
- Moderate amount of blood
Hot-Blooded: Slight increase in physical strength. Cold-Blooded: Your skin becomes as tough as leather armor Out for Blood weapons become as durable as steel but will still shatter and catch on fire.
- Major amount of blood
Hot-Blooded: Moderate increase in physical strength. Out for Blood weapons can cauterize wounds Cold-Blooded: Your skin becomes as tough as beast hide and Out for Blood weapons can cause frostbite
Blood for Blood's Hot-Blooded and Cold-Blooded enhancements do not stack with other physical power enhancing abilities of the same kind.
